Schaub Colonial Appliance Pull is an appliance pull designed for appliance panels that need a robust decorative handle with a consistent grip line. The concealed surface style keeps mounting points hidden on the face, which helps achieve a clean, finished look on visible appliance fronts. The 12 inch center-to-center layout spaces the mounting holes at 12 inches, which suits wider appliance panels that need a broad hand grab. The satin nickel finish presents a muted metallic appearance, which works well where a project calls for a nickel tone without high glare. The 1/4-20 thread size matches a common machine thread pattern, which simplifies pairing the pull with properly tapped mounting points or matching fasteners during installation. Branded by Schaub and Company within their handles and pulls class, this pull fits decorative hardware projects that call for a coordinated look across cabinetry and appliance faces.
